    About Rosetta Assisted Living - Missoula 2

    Rosetta Assisted Living - Missoula 2 provides a safe and comfortable place for seniors who need help with daily activities but want to keep as much independence as possible, and you'll find the facility set among the Montana landscape at 1300 Speedway in Missoula, though there are properties on 3018 Rattlesnake Dr., 2406 River Rd, and 2814 Great Northern Loop under the Rosetta name, so when you look for the place, make sure you're clear about which one you mean, since these are smaller places, not huge buildings stacked with rooms, and the Speedway address can house up to 12 adults, offering a mix of private rooms, couple-friendly spaces, and even premium options if someone wants a little more space, and in each unit or bedroom, seniors get the peace of knowing staff are always nearby for help, whether with bathing, dressing, or moving around the building, even if they use a walker or wheelchair or can't get around on their own, with an emergency alert call system so someone can respond quickly if needed. The setup covers both private pay and Medicaid residents, so a wide range of folks can get the help they need, and each person's care gets planned just for them, covering things like medicine, bathing, clothing, toileting, transfers, and help with memory conditions, including Alzheimer's, dementia, and Parkinson's, since they do have secured memory care services at this address, with supervision all day and night, and a nurse on site along with scheduled medical checkups every month so families don't have to worry as much about health slipping through the cracks. You'll see laundry, housekeeping, and apartment cleaning are part of the usual routine, and meals are cooked and served restaurant-style in the dining room, with special diets or allergies taken into account, so there's usually something everyone can eat and the cooks aim to make things easy, not fancy, but safe. Community features include a garden, walking paths, regular movie nights, a library, a computer room, and a chapel for folks wanting a quiet spot, along with fun activities like group outings, fitness classes, arts and crafts, resident-led games, or just a coffee chat, plus a cafe for casual snacks. Seniors can join adult day services if they're not moving in full-time, and there are monthly activities aimed at keeping people involved and social without being overwhelming. Staff stay available 24/7 for any needs, and the buildings carry the proper Montana licenses under numbers like 13398 and 31477, so everything's regulated. Residents don't have to deal with shoveling snow, fixing things, or cooking every day, since the place aims to remove chores and bring peace, and the community works for singles or married couples, who can ask about bringing pets if that matters to them. Each apartment may have a kitchenette or use the communal kitchen and private rooms come furnished if needed, and services adjust based on what each person needs, whether they're mobile or need a lot of help. There are options for one-bedroom units, studios, or more communal settings, so you can find something that fits, and the whole setup is simple and practical, focused on comfort and safety rather than fancy extras.
